xTrek: An Influence-Aware Technique for Dijkstra’s and A Pathfinders

Figure 10

Distinct paths found within the arena2 map of Dragon Age: Origins by (a) , (b) T, (c) RAP, and (d) CAN pathfinders. Cyan nodes are neutral nodes visited during the space search. T repulsor nodes in (b) maintain their original dark lilac-to-light-lilac colors because they were not visited. Therefore, and like DjT, T repulsors sustain the space search. On the contrary, CAN repulsors in (d) do not contain the space search because their original dark lilac-to-light-lilac colors were combined with cyan, resulting in purple-blue colored nodes. This color change means that CAN repulsor nodes were visited. Also, the attractor nodes in (b) and (d) are in dark red-to-green because they were visited: that is, their original red-to-yellow color was blended with cyan. In turn, the RAP repulsors (in light lilac) in (c) also sustain the expansion of the space search, though repulsor nodes own the same color because their influence values are constant in DjRAP.
